Job Title: Recruitment Marketing Executive
Contract and Hours: Permanent, 37.5 hours per week
Salary: £25,000 – £29,000 dependent on experience
Location: Hybrid- homeworking with a minimum of 3 days per week in the Bradford office
About the role
We are looking for a confident individual with a passion for a career in marketing with a continual desire to grow and build on experience.
Working with the Recruitment Marketing Manager and the wider Communications & Marketing team, you will provide a professional and effective recruitment marketing service, delivering marketing expertise and campaign management to support the objectives of the Recruitment team.
You will:
- Create high quality written and video content for Anchor’s recruitment social media accounts, recruitment campaigns and the careers website
- Maintain and improve Anchor’s employer brand reputation on Indeed and Glassdoor, plus monitor/respond to reviews
- Support the Recruitment Marketing Manager in ensuring the employer brand is delivered across campaigns, activities and collateral.
- Obtain testimonials from colleagues to use on social media, blogs, PR case studies and in campaigns.
- Manage specialist job board advertising, liaising with Anchor’s external media agency and the recruitment team to identify, book and post ad hoc job adverts.
About you
You will:
- Have strong written communication and ability to write to a set tone of voice and brand guidelines.
- Have good communication skills with confidence to engage with colleagues at different levels of seniority.
- Be able to prioritise and manage multiple projects at any one time.
- Have strong commitment to, and understanding of, confidentiality.
- Support a climate where diversity is valued and celebrated.
- Have copywriting and content generation experience
- Have proofreading experience
- Have some marketing experience especially around social media or content creation – this would be beneficial but not essential.
Anchor – a great place to work
Anchor is England’s largest not-for-profit providers of care and housing for older people. Our heartfelt ambition is to transform housing and care so everyone can have a home where they love living in later life.
We’re not-for-profit which means every penny we make or save is invested in the people who live with us, the places they live and the people who work here. That means a better standard of care and customer service, better wages, more investment in training and development and improved facilities.
